#[repr(u8)]pub enum ExtensionId {
OctEncodedVertexNormals = 1,
WaterMask = 2,
Metadata = 4,
}Expand description
Extension IDs for quantized-mesh format.
Variants§
OctEncodedVertexNormals = 1
Oct-encoded per-vertex normals (2 bytes per vertex)
WaterMask = 2
Water mask (1 byte or 256x256 bytes)
Metadata = 4
JSON metadata
Trait Implementations§
Source§impl Clone for ExtensionId
impl Clone for ExtensionId
Source§fn clone(&self) -> ExtensionId
fn clone(&self) -> ExtensionId
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ExtensionId
impl Debug for ExtensionId
Source§impl PartialEq for ExtensionId
impl PartialEq for ExtensionId
Source§fn eq(&self, other: &ExtensionId) -> bool
fn eq(&self, other: &ExtensionId) -> bool
Tests for
self and other values to be equal, and is used by ==.impl Copy for ExtensionId
impl Eq for ExtensionId
impl StructuralPartialEq for ExtensionId
Auto Trait Implementations§
impl Freeze for ExtensionId
impl RefUnwindSafe for ExtensionId
impl Send for ExtensionId
impl Sync for ExtensionId
impl Unpin for ExtensionId
impl UnsafeUnpin for ExtensionId
impl UnwindSafe for ExtensionId
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more